Output 9c08768566749e40c0f2d7fb1e6d68ec813c21aff5a442572f46251dfe35d07e:1

value
12579508
script pubkey
OP_0 OP_PUSHBYTES_32 edfe26a92acd0ec96151164c9c8c32437720bea7aaa165d8b0c834150ac502a8
address
bc1qahlzd2f2e58vjc23zexferpjgdmjp04842sktk9seq6p2zk9q25qah5nqu
transaction
9c08768566749e40c0f2d7fb1e6d68ec813c21aff5a442572f46251dfe35d07e
spent
true